Ensisheim
Enseignement-formation
In 2024, Ensisheim spent 638 k€ on this. That is €85 per inhabitant.
Against towns of the same size
−9.2 pt Ensisheim devotes 8.3% of its operating budget to this; the median for towns of 5,000 to 10,000 inhabitants is 17.5%.
Ranked 1022 of 1176 by share of budget.In euros per inhabitant: €85, against €180 for the median (−52 %).
